A former WWE star and her partner made headlines after walking out of AEW Collision this weekend. Now, a new report has surfaced that sheds light on the reason why they did so.

That star is Nixon Newell (fka Tegan Nox), a former WWE wrestler who was released from the company in November 2024. Newell quickly returned to the independent circuit and spent about a year there before making a surprising debut on the October 25 episode of Collision alongside her partner Miranda Alize. The duo confronted Anna Jay and Tay Melo (collectively known as TayJay) in a backstage segment. A week later, they made their in-ring debut in a losing effort against Marina Shafir and Megan Bayne.

On this week's Collision, they were scheduled to face TayJay. However, earlier reports confirmed that Newell and Alize walked out of Collision an hour before their match. At the time, it was reported that their walkout was allegedly due to being asked to put TayJay over, but they refused. According to the latest update from Fightful, this was not the case.

Sean Ross Sapp of Fightful Select reported that the duo specifically wanted more time rather than winning their match against Anna Jay and Tay Melo. The report also suggested that there will be more updates on Newell's and Alize's brief run in AEW.

Nixon Newell recently spoke on her dream matches in AEW

A few months ahead of her debut in AEW, Nixon Newell had made an appearance on We Just Talk Wrestling, where she was asked about her dream opponents in the Jacksonville-based promotion.

"There's so many. Kris Statlander, that could be a banger. Mercedes Mone, I'd like to run that back with her again. Athena. Dude, there's so many people I want to wrestle. Willow Nightingale. So many people. So many people I want to wrestle. So Toni Storm's up there, just because I wrestled Toni for a very, very long time... Alex Windsor, obviously, big history with her," Newell said.

Now, with the walkout incident, it'll be interesting to see if fans will ever see Newell or Alize on AEW programming again.
